摘要
本文用破开算子法对三维泥沙扩散问题建立了数值模型,对破开后的四个微分方程分别采用不同的差分格式进行计算,利用垂向坐标变换技术,使垂直方向网格划分更有利于泥沙扩散物理过程的描述,避免了底边几何形状不规则所造成的计算复杂和不稳定,该模型应用在镇海某原油码头疏浚引起泥沙扩散对周围地区的影响上,取得有价值的成果。
This paper describes the development of a three-dimensional numerical model of dredgedsediment transport.Using a splitting method,the basic equation is splited up into four finitedifference forms.A vertical coordinate transformation is described.This transformation has theadvantages of mapping the free surface and bottom boundaries onto coordinate surfaces and allowing for a uniform vertical grid resolution throughout the modeled region. This model hasbeen applied successfully in simulation of sediment transport caused by a harbor dredging.
